Table 3 Pregnancy outcomes and neonatal evaluations

From: Fetal umbilical artery thrombosis: prenatal diagnosis, treatment and follow-up

 

UAT (n = 30)

Control (n = 35)

p

Pattern of delivery

Cesarean section

72.4% (21/29)

23.5% (8/34)

0.000

Vaginal delivery

27.6% (8/29)

76.5% (26/34)

 

Adverse pregnancy outcomes

50.0%

5.7%

0.000

Stillbirth

13.3%

0.0%

0.040

Preterm birth

33.3%

2.9%

0.001

SGA

6.7%

2.9%

0.591

GA at birth (w)

36.13 ± 3.27

38.63 ± 1.22

0.000

Birth weight (kg)

2.60 ± 0.73

3.20 ± 0.37

0.000

Sex (male)

60.0% (15/25)

54.5% (18/33)

0.678

Apgar score

10.0 (7.5, 10.0)

10.0 (10.0, 10.0)

0.000

Fetal distress

37.9% (11/29)

0.0% (0/34)

0.000

  1. p value, UAT group vs. control group. Adverse pregnancy outcomes included stillbirth, preterm birth and small for gestational age (SGA). GA, gestational age
